The video discusses the challenges investors face in emerging markets, highlighting the shift from growth to value stocks due to their steady performance. Analysts support this shift, noting that earnings estimates for value stocks remain positive compared to growth stocks. The video also explores the potential for market rebound, focusing on ETFs and the put-call ratio as indicators of investor sentiment. Overall, the message is that value stocks are currently a safer investment choice.
